    • Grocery Outlet Holding Corp. Announces New President and Chief Executive Officer

      EMERYVILLE, Calif., Jan. 22, 2025 (GLOBE NEWSWIRE) -- Grocery Outlet Holding Corp. (NASDAQ:GO) ("Grocery Outlet" or the "Company"), today announced the appointment of Jason Potter as the Company's President and Chief Executive Officer, effective February 3, 2025. Mr. Potter will also join the Company's Board of Directors. Mr. Potter is a seasoned CEO, bringing more than 30 years of grocery retail experience and a track record of driving earnings growth and shareholder value. He joins Grocery Outlet from The Fresh Market, a specialty grocery retailer of fresh, gourmet food and prepared meals, where he has served as CEO and a board member since March 2020.     • Grocery Outlet Holding Corp. Announces Appointment of New Chief Financial Officer

      EMERYVILLE, Calif., Dec. 18, 2024 (GLOBE NEWSWIRE) -- Grocery Outlet Holding Corp. (NASDAQ:GO) ("Grocery Outlet" or the "Company"), today announced the appointment of Christopher Miller as Executive Vice President and Chief Financial Officer, effective January 6, 2025. He will report directly to Eric Lindberg, Grocery Outlet's Chairman of the Board and Interim President and Chief Executive Officer. Mr. Miller joins Grocery Outlet from Shamrock Foods Company, the largest family-held food service distributor in the western United States, where he was the company's CFO for nearly two years.
